    At times, we decide to challenge ourselves. To see, if we can reach for something new, something…read moreunexpected, something that will push our senses to new heights. I am of course talking about arriving in a new city and embarking on a quest to find the best burger. In Nashville burger lover circles, Grillshack is often noted as one of the establishments. It's been here in East Nashville since the year 2013. Yes, same year when Breaking Bad came out and when Miley Cyrus twerked on the award stage. The spot is ran by a husband and wife duo Steve and Susan Richter, with a focus on locally sourced ingredients like locally baked buns from Charpier's Bakery and ingredients from Bear Creek Farm. The burger is executed in a highly classic way, with only the cheese, the meat and the bun combined, with all else on the side. The result is a fairly small, enjoyable burger, but with a very heavy bread to meat proportion (that is a matter of preference). The meat is a bit in the drier side and not particularly rich in flavor, but the burger is well composed and does not fall apart. There are a few tables outside to sit under a covered area and enjoy an American classic. In other words, Grillshack is a staple neighborhood local joint for those in the know and those who have a particular like towards this style: bread heavy, minimalistic and dry crispy texture to the meat. Not necessarily all bad things, but a matter of preference.

    One of my favorite ways to discover restaurants is through OpenTable. Sure, I enjoy collecting the…read morepoints, but the real reward is finding places I probably would have walked right past otherwise. Music Row Bar & Grill was one of those discoveries, and I'm glad I made the reservation. Located in the beautiful Music Row neighborhood near Vanderbilt University, it's an easy stop whether you're a local or exploring Nashville on foot. The restaurant has its own parking lot, which is always a welcome bonus, and the dining room strikes a nice balance between polished and relaxed. I settled into a comfortable banquette and immediately felt at home. I started with the Fig Salad, a mountain of fresh greens topped with figs, goat cheese, toasted almonds, and a light honey vinaigrette. After several days of barbecue and protein-heavy meals, it was exactly what I needed. Fresh, colorful, and generously portioned. For my entrée, I ordered the skirt steak from the tapas menu with beet chimichurri. What a great choice. The steak was tender and flavorful, while the earthy sweetness of the beets gave the chimichurri an unexpected twist that worked beautifully. It's the kind of dish that reminds you why trying something new is always worth it. Service was warm, attentive, and never rushed. It was clear many of the guests were locals greeting familiar faces, which always says something about a neighborhood restaurant. The atmosphere felt authentic rather than touristy. The best part? Just a short walk away is Van Leeuwen Ice Cream. Skip dessert here and stroll over afterward. Dinner followed by artisan ice cream makes for a pretty perfect Nashville evening.
